A Technical Guide to Evaluating VPN Software Free Trials
A Virtual Private Network (VPN) is a critical tool for enhancing online privacy, security, and freedom. However, not all VPN services perform equally. A free trial offers a risk-free opportunity to conduct a thorough technical evaluation before committing to a subscription. This guide outlines a professional protocol for testing a VPN during its trial period.
Understanding the Value of a VPN Free Trial
A free trial allows you to test a VPN's real-world performance on your specific network and devices. Marketing claims can be verified, and you can assess factors that are highly dependent on your location and internet service provider (ISP). The goal is to move beyond feature lists and measure tangible results in speed, security, and usability.
Key Features to Test During Your Trial
Focus your evaluation on these core technical aspects:
- Performance and Speed: A VPN will inevitably introduce some overhead, but a good service minimizes this impact. Test download/upload speeds and latency (ping) on various servers, both local and international.
- Security Protocols and Encryption: Ensure the service offers modern, secure protocols like OpenVPN and WireGuard with AES-256 encryption.
- Kill Switch Functionality: This is a non-negotiable security feature. A kill switch immediately cuts your internet access if the VPN connection drops, preventing your real IP address from being exposed. Test this feature rigorously.
- DNS and IP Leak Protection: Use third-party online tools to verify that the VPN is not leaking your DNS requests or your real IP address. A secure VPN should route all traffic, including DNS queries, through its encrypted tunnel.
- Server Network and Geo-Unblocking: Test the breadth and reliability of the server network. Attempt to connect to servers in different regions to access geo-restricted content and check for consistent connectivity.
- Client Stability and Usability: The software client should be stable, intuitive, and resource-efficient. Evaluate it on all devices you plan to use, including desktop and mobile.
A Step-by-Step Evaluation Protocol
Follow this structured process to ensure a comprehensive test:
- Establish a Baseline: Before activating the VPN, run a speed test (e.g., using Speedtest.net or Fast.com) to record your baseline internet performance.
- Install and Configure: Note the ease of installation and the clarity of the settings within the VPN client. Explore advanced configuration options.
- Conduct Performance Tests: Connect to a recommended or "fastest" server and re-run the speed test. Then, connect to several international servers relevant to your needs and repeat the tests. Document the percentage drop in speed.
- Perform Security Audits: While connected, visit sites like ipleak.net or dnsleaktest.com. Confirm that the displayed IP address and DNS servers belong to the VPN provider, not your ISP.
- Test the Kill Switch: With the VPN active, manually disconnect your Wi-Fi or unplug your Ethernet cable. Your internet access should be completely blocked until the VPN reconnects or you manually disable the feature.
- Simulate Real-World Usage: Spend time streaming high-definition video, browsing content-heavy websites, and performing other typical online activities to check for buffering, lag, or connection drops.
Post-Trial Considerations
At the end of the trial, review your findings. Did the VPN meet your performance and security requirements? Was the software easy to use? Crucially, be aware of the trial's expiration date and the provider's auto-renewal policy to avoid unwanted charges.
